Output fa23a123b88b08261103844ec5e8a961ea755cdb0bcdc8212684105592ac6e03:0

value
182250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7dbceeccf58ec285a60d5d340dd791570c664323 OP_EQUALVERIFY OP_CHECKSIG
address
1CTqoG8jiLtjLki7X4BYcEosAPhPzs9Q7A
transaction
fa23a123b88b08261103844ec5e8a961ea755cdb0bcdc8212684105592ac6e03
spent
true